hi drstawl,

I got Vegas Pro with my delta 1010 bundle, and it also came with Siren express and xfx 1

I don't mess with the compressor anymore, but I noticed that it did not even work as it was supposed to. I mainly tried using it to get my sounds louder, but if I increased the input by 5db, it would still clip even if I set the compression to infinity.

As for the eq, the problem with that is that it is either not enough or too much.

on my vocals, I used to high-pass 150hz , cut about 2 db from 3.5 and high-shelf about 6 db from 12k

and it makes it sound grainier, like it suddenly converted my 24 bit data to like 16 bits or so.

the reverb is what erks me. When I listen to professional reverbs, they sound reverbed. When I listen to mine, it sounds like , I don't know how to describe it, maybe like the reverb I used to get on my karaorke machine

but hmm, that's the difference with using a plug in and using somehting like a lexicon reverb which is what pro's use. i did an a/b test on a reverb on my pro tools system and compared it with my lexicon pcm 80, HELL OF A LOT OF DIFFERENCE.
you get what you pay for.

some studio reverbs such as the lexicon 480L 5 channel one costs like £12,000. cant really compare it to a plug in.
